Post by: Mark on June 05, 2015, 04:11:16 AM
you may want to wait until after we play with it at the con. . .

Hawaii and the sea zones between Hawaii and the West Coast are probably the biggest changes. 
1) I wanted the Allies to be able to invade Hawaii from the West Coast if it fell
2) I wanted the Japanese to be able to airbase attack the fighter based on Hawaii when they attack Pearl Harbor

Other changes include changing many of the islands to arid/desert (sand) for the smaller atolls rather than forest/jungle.

Some ports got moved around (like the Guadalcanal port space is now on the North side of the island).  Should make the Solomon Sea even more of a battleground.

Added the additional territory for the Philippines.  Wanted to make amphibious invasions here a little easier and have more of a potentially drawn out ground campaign.

We will see how all of it works - we played a couple games on this revised map and liked it so far.
